Best of the box. Not sure if it counts... But both of my testers placed top 3.
1) Carnival of Light - caramel apple. This is more like the caramel apple sucker than a true caramel apple. But i definitely enjoyed it! I vaped it all up in short order.

2) frisco Marina - mango hi-chew. That is exactly what it is. It isnt spot on, but it is really close and very enjoyable vape. Could be an ADV if light mango is your thing.

3) Good Day Sunshine - watermelon hard candy. Some would say that it is like a jolly rancher. But I disagree... It is more like those hard candies in your grandma's candy dish... Except its watermelon. Which I prefer. Not overwhelming or too sweet, but sweet enough to satisfy and mellow enough that you want more. I wasnt going to include this in the BoB, but in the end i preferred it to my other bottles.

4) Boosted - Boosted. Strawberry Cream/Custard. This one turned out much better on fresh cotton. A very buttery custard type flavor. I love butter so, this one initially was in 3rd, but i wound up enjoying the GDS more. My wife, unfortunately tossed the bottle, so i used the card to represent it.

5) Fogium - Ohana. Caramel custard. This one really reminds me of Kings Crown claim your throne. It's pretty good, a standard caramel custard. Sometimes simple is all you need.

Not shown:
True North - Fathom. Dark berries. It did get better on fresh cotton. I liked the realistic bitter of the finish of a dark berry... But the sweetness wasnt quite right, and i think that is where the odd flavor is coming from... Whatever they are using to try to sweeten it. I wound up giving the bottle to a friend who really liked Fathom. I did try it on 2 different builds and fresh cotton... Same result.

Ripe Vapes - Coconut thai. I did not include this in the BoB since it was a surprise gift and all. I defensively get the lemongrass and a thai chili powder taste... I dont get the conconut, though. It took me a few vapes to decide how i felt about this one. However, i wound up really enjoying it. It is totally different from any other vape and i do enjoy the warm spice in it. It's pretty complex and not an ADV for me, but it is a nice change up in my daily rotation. High marks for originality.

I was not expecting too much from Boosted as I saw someone say it was just another strawberry custard, but I really like it. I thought it tasted more like a creamy rice pudding with strawberry jam (Jelly) than a strawberry custard. Very smooth and I do get the sort of buttery biscuit (cookie) taste too. Overall it is pretty delicious and I would certainly rate it well above Unicorn Milk (tasted too soapy for me). I really wanted to try Strawberry Blonde this month too, but it wasn't to be.

The London Bridges was quite a surprise, I was expecting creme brulee with a black english tea (as per the description), but it is creme brulee with lady or earl grey tea, very floral. It reminded me of going to church in my youth, the smell of incense and all that. It has a refreshing feel to it and I love the creaminess coming in at the end. I have a sort of love hate relationship with this one (I did vape 5ml of it yesterday though), for me it could do with being a little less sweet, as we all know, it is a crime against tea to be putting sugar in Earl/Lady Grey.

I agree on the Hoops, I am leaving it for a bit as it is a bit too intense for me at the moment, just too much melon and not a lot else. Queen's Custard is also getting a bit longer to steep, I did try it, but it has a distinct alcohol taste (probably due to the vanilla flavouring used). So, I will leave it with it's cap off for a while and hope it goes away.

CR3AM I thought was just OK, nothing special. It does taste like a biscuit we have here called a Bourbon cream, which is less creamy than an oreo and more of a dry cocoa flavour. There was nothing wrong with this juice, it is fine and all, but just a bit meh. It could do with being a bit more creamy I think.

The Tester this month was pretty good for me (Hello Goodbye). I get a strong orange Tic-Tac flavour to start with (orange menthol) and then a very nice smooth creamy butter icing taste as a finish. Really a great mix, a powerful punch to start and a delightful soft ending. It is slightly harsh on the throat though (in a dripper), but all in all a very pleasurable vape.

I am really disappointed in getting the Widow Maker (Blueberry Cream), I have tried it and it is horrible. It just makes me feel a bit sick. I don't know if they exist, but to me it tastes like what I imagine a blueberry car air freshener would taste like. I am sure that if you like blueberry then you might like this juice, but this juice is not going to get vaped by me.

I wish they had sent me CRFT Strawberry Blonde instead of a flavour mentioned on my 'dislike' list.
